CVE-2024-9404: Denial-of-Service Vulnerability

First published: Wed Dec 04 2024(Updated: )

This vulnerability could lead to denial-of-service or service crashes. Exploitation of the moxa_cmd service, because of insufficient input validation, allows attackers to disrupt operations. If exposed to public networks, the vulnerability poses a significant remote threat, potentially allowing attackers to shut down affected systems.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the severity of CVE-2024-9404?

    CVE-2024-9404 has been classified as a medium-severity vulnerability.

  • How does CVE-2024-9404 affect Moxa IP Cameras?

    CVE-2024-9404 can lead to a denial-of-service condition or cause a service crash in Moxa IP Cameras.

  • Which Moxa products are affected by CVE-2024-9404?

    The vulnerability CVE-2024-9404 specifically affects the Moxa VPort 07-3 Series IP Cameras.

  • What could an attacker achieve by exploiting CVE-2024-9404?

    Exploiting CVE-2024-9404 could allow an attacker to disrupt the service on affected Moxa devices.

  • How can I mitigate the risks associated with CVE-2024-9404?

    To mitigate the risks of CVE-2024-9404, users should apply any available patches or updates from Moxa for the affected products.
